Combustion Flue Gas Analyzers
Rosemount Analytical's combustion flue gas analyzers measure the gases flowing out of large industrial boilers and furnaces to improve combustion efficiency.
 | The 6888 analyzer provides accurate measurement of the oxygen remaining in flue gases coming from any combustion process. |
 | The CCO 5500 Carbon Monoxide (CO) Analyzer uses infrared absorption spectroscopy to continuously measure CO concentration in combustion flue gases. |
 | The 5081FG Two-Wire In Situ Oxygen Analyzer utilizes a zirconium oxide sensor to measure excess oxygen in combustion processes and can operates at high temperatures 550° to 1400°C (1022° to 2550°F). |
 | The OPM 3000 Opacity Dust Density Monitor radio measurement technique provides automatic compensation for variations in light source intensity to ensure prolonged instrument accuracy and stability. |
 | The OPM 4000 is a high performance opacity monitoring system with double-pass transmissometer, which uses field-proven and time-tested optics and circuitry that is simple, yet accurate. |
 | The OxyBalance system is a display and averaging system that assists plant operations in setting overall fuel/air ratios as well as providing a tool for balancing individual burners or sets of burners. |
